IN THE UNITED STATES COURT OF FEDERAL CLAIMS LAWRENCE S. LEWIN and MARION E. LEWIN, Plaintiffs, v. UNITED STATES OF AMERICA Defendant. § § § § § § § § § § §
NO. 1:06-cv-00751 Judge Mary Ellen Coster Williams
STIPULATION FOR DISMISSAL It is hereby stipulated and agreed that the complaint in the above entitled case be dismissed with prejudice, the parties to bear their respective costs, including any possible attorney's fees and other expenses of this litigation. Counsel for the United States has authorized Plaintiffs' counsel to sign this stipulation on their behalf. Respectfully submitted,
